Sacrament of Baptism
Baptism is the first step to become a Catholic Christian. Parents who wish to baptize their children agree to raise them in the Catholic faith. For more
information about the requirements for infant baptisms, check the bulletin or call Deacon Dan. Classes are the 2nd Saturday of each month in the Faith
Formation Complex room 13 at 9 am. For Spanish, classes are the 3rd Thursday of each month at 6:30pm in the Faith Formation Complex room 13.

Sacrament of Reconciliation
God loves us and wants to forgive our sins. You can experience Gods unconditional love through the Sacrament of Reconciliation. This
sacrament is available on Tuesdays from 8:30 to 9:00 am, and on Saturdays, English & Spanish, from 3:30 to 4:30 pm, or at other times by
contacting a priest.

Sacrament of Marriage
Please contact the parish a minimum of six months prior to the wedding. Do not set a date prior to your first appointment with a priest or
deacon. If the wedding is to take place elsewhere, please seek advice from our clergy. For more information, please contact the Parish
Office at 702-970-2500.

Funeral Arrangements
Please contact the Parish Office at 702-970-2500 as soon as possible after a death to make the funeral arrangements. Services can be in
English, Spanish or Bilingual.

Emergency Calls
A hospital chaplain covers all hospitals. In an emergency, please contact the hospital. After hours, please leave a message with the Parish
Office and you will be contacted the next business day.

CANONICAL- LITURGICAL FORUM


BY FR. GEM BANDIVAS, JCL, MBA, PhD

MARRIAGE AFTER A PRESUMPTION OF DEATH


Dear Father Gem: I have a unique hypothetical scenario on
marriage. A couple is on a trip in their yacht. One morning the
wife wakes up and notices that her husband is gone. After an
intense search, the Coast Guard concludes that he fell off the
boat and died, although the body was not recovered.
Two years later, after the Church officially declared a
presumption of death of the missing husband, the lady
marries again in the Church. But after some time the first
husband reappears and says he was kidnapped by pirates
and just got liberated. Which of the two men is the legitimate
husband now?
ANGELINA, Concerned Catholic
Dear Angelina: The scenario that you describe is far from unique.
But thank you anyway for bringing this up. Any Catholic whose
soldier spouse is missing in action particularly during wartime and
presumed dead will encounter the very same problem, if he/she
eventually remarries and the first spouse later turns up alive after
all. The Code of Canon Law stipulates lengthily on this scenario.
Lets try to take a look.
Catholic theology holds that marriage is for life, and Canon
Law always follows Theology. Once one has validly married, and
the marriage has been consummated, only death can dissolve it
(c. 1141).
You are on-target when you envision that the wife in your
imaginary scenario must obtain an official declaration that her
husband is presumed dead. In this type of case, since there is no
direct official evidence of the husbands death (such as an
ordinary civil death certificate, or a record in a parish registry
attesting to a funeral), canonically the wife does not have the
authority to decide on her own that she is now a widow and free to
remarry in the Church. More is needed, and canon 1707 explains
what procedurally must be done.
The first paragraph of this canon notes that whenever the
death of a spouse cannot be proven by an authentic ecclesiastical
or civil document, the other spouse is not regarded as free from
the bond of marriage until the diocesan bishop issues a
declaration that death is presumed. The next paragraph provides a
general description of what the bishop has to do: he can only
make such a declaration after investigating the circumstances,
hearing the testimony of witnesses and reviewing other relevant
evidenceand reaching moral certainty concerning the death of
the spouse (c. 1707.2).
Moral certitude is a concept that comes up rather frequently
in Moral Theology, and also in the canons of the Code pertaining
to court procedures. This term could be said to be the theological
approximation of the Civil Law standard of beyond a shadow of a
doubt. In other words, the Church acknowledges that unless a
person actually witnessed an incident himself, he cant necessarily
know the truth with 100% empirical assurance. The possibility
always exists, however slight, that he is wrong! But in many cases,
practically speaking, achieving moral certitude based on the
existing proofs is the best that any mere mortal can doso the
Church accepts it as sufficient.
The same canon 1707.2 also notes specifically that the mere
absence of a spouse, even for a very long period, does not in itself
constitute sufficient evidence that he/she may be dead, so more
proof is needed. A couple of concrete examples may serve to
illustrate this more clearly.

Lets say that Glorias husband Johnny is a soldier fighting


the enemy in a tropical jungle. Several of his fellow servicemen
saw him running ahead of them before he totally disappeared from
view. They discover a pool of quicksand in the area where Johnny
was running, and since it encompasses the whole area, there is no
conceivable way he could have avoided it. Theres no body and no
eyewitness evidence, but Johnny must have fallen into the
quicksand, because he couldnt have gone anywhere else! If
Gloria later wants to remarry in the Church, the testimony of her
husbands fellow-soldiers, and a description of the terrain involved,
might easily convince her bishop to issue the declaration of
presumed death required by canon 1707.
But not every case is going to be so clear. To take another
example, lets imagine that Susan and Ernie have been married for
several years, and one day Ernie comes home from work to
discover that Susan has completely disappeared. There is no
evidence of foul play, and even after an extensive search the
police cannot locate any sign of her. Susan simply vanished
without a trace! Now lets say that after three years, and no news
about Susan, Ernie wants to remarry in the Church. Can he do
that?
As sad as it may seem, under such circumstances the
diocesan bishop would be hard-pressed to issue a declaration of
Susans presumption of death. Its quite possible that despite the
lack of evidence, Susan was abducted and killedbut its just as
possible that Susan secretly decided to leave her husband and
has run off with another man. Susan may be alive and welland,
having successfully evaded the police searches, she may be living
a new life in a far-away city. Given the total lack of evidence either
way, its difficult to envision a bishop finding any grounds for moral
certitude in such a case.
Now weve seen in general how the process should work. So
what happens now? Actually, the answer to this reasonable
question is not spelled out in the codebecause as noted at the
beginning, the Church teaches that marriage is for life, and so if
the first spouse is really still alive, then the marriage has not
ended!
Therefore if the (very human) bishop has reasonablyyet
erroneouslyconcluded after an appropriate investigation that the
spouse must be dead, and the survivor remarried, the second
marriage is in fact not valid. Note that this is certainly not the fault
of any of the parties involved.
So if the original spouse later turns up, the non-widow(er)
has to separate from the second spouse and return to the first.
Obviously this is going to be a very painful experience for all three
of them! But despite everybodys good faith, and regardless of
what the remarried spouse might personally prefer to do, there is
just no way that the second marriage is valid. Thats because only
deathand not a piece of paper from the bishopcan actually
dissolve the first marriage. No death simply means no
dissolution. Period.
While this tragic set of circumstances fortunately doesnt
happen every day, the scenario does arise frequently enough that
the Church determined it was best to spell out the right way to
handle it from a procedural standpoint. Combine the procedure
explained in the Code with Catholic teaching on the indissolubility
of marriage, you will have the answer to your very good question.
